Necrotic Gnome, the publisher responsible for popular retroclone RPG Old-School Essentials, is partnering with Exalted Funeral to host a collaborative crowdfunding project on Backerkit. Old-School Essentials Month will run through May 2026 and, like its Mothership and Mausritter cousins, invite independent designers to launch their own OSE projects under a shared banner. Themed months are interesting twists on the crowdfunding formula and benefit from tapped-in creator followings, which OSE definitely boasts.

But, hoo boy, the calendar is already getting crowded.

Let’s take stock of a given year, assuming you’re interested in a general range of non-elfgame RPGs. February is both Zine Quest on Kickstarter and the independent Zine Month offshoot that spawned in protest a few years back. Backerkit cut  its own piece of the small-form, stapled pie by adding ZineTopia to the same month. Speaking of -Topias, late March/early April brings along Pocketopia, an event that differs from ZineTopia in ways you can understand if you squint hard enough at the description. 

October is the aforementioned Mothership Month on Backerkit, which has notched two successful years in its belt, and Gamefound’s RPG Party. This invitational showcase of projects is a bit more curated, but I’ll count it. Backerkit immediately returns in November with Mausritter Month, alternating one rules-lite system with robust 3rd-party support for another. Necrotic Gnome and Exalted Press have opted, at least, for a relatively empty block – oh, wait, no, Pocketopia 2026 is now happening in May, as well.
